React vs Angular — Which One Should You Learn as a Developer? Many developers ask: React or Angular? The answer depends on how you like to build applications. Let’s break it down simply 👇 🔹 React ✅ Library, not a full framework ✅ Uses JavaScript (JSX) ✅ Flexible & lightweight ✅ Huge community & ecosystem ✅ Faster learning curve for beginners 📌 Best suited for: Modern web apps Startups & product-based companies Developers who prefer flexibility 🔹 Angular ✅ Full-fledged framework ✅ Uses TypeScript by default ✅ Strong structure & architecture ✅ Built-in features (routing, forms, HTTP, etc.) ✅ Ideal for enterprise-level applications 📌 Best suited for: Large-scale applications Enterprise & corporate projects Developers who like structured coding 🧠 Key Differences at a Glance 👉 React = Flexibility + UI focused 👉 Angular = Structure + Complete solution 👉 React lets you choose tools 👉 Angular gives you everything out of the box 🚀 So, Which One Should You Learn? ✔ Choose React if you want faster entry into frontend roles ✔ Choose Angular if you aim for enterprise projects ✔ Learning one makes the other easier 💬 Which one are you using or planning to learn — React or Angular? Let’s discuss 👇 #React #Angular #FrontendDevelopment #WebDevelopment #JavaScript #TypeScript #LearnInPublic #ITCareers #SoftwareDeveloper
React vs Angular: Choosing the Right Framework for Your Needs
More Relevant Posts
-
Angular vs React – Which One is Best? 🤔💻 Choosing between Angular and React depends on project requirements, scalability goals, and developer preference. Both are powerful technologies used to build modern, high-performance web applications. 🚀 🔷 Angular ✅ Full-fledged framework ✅ Built-in tools & structured architecture ✅ TypeScript support by default ✅ Best for large-scale enterprise applications ⚛️ React ✅ Lightweight and flexible library ✅ Faster learning curve ✅ Huge community & ecosystem ✅ Ideal for dynamic and interactive UI development 📊 Performance & Popularity React is widely adopted due to its flexibility and reusable components, while Angular is preferred for complex, structured, and enterprise-level projects. 🎯 Final Verdict There is no“one-size-fits-all” choice. React offers flexibility and speed, whereas Angular provides a complete, structured development environment. The best option depends on your project needs and development goals. #WebDevelopment #FrontendDevelopment #Angular #ReactJS #Programming #SoftwareDevelopment
To view or add a comment, sign in
-
-
A career in development isn’t a shortcut — it’s a journey 🚀 Built one concept, one project, one mistake at a time 🧠💻 Start with the fundamentals 🧱 HTML gives structure, CSS brings life, JavaScript adds intelligence ⚡ Because trends change, but strong basics never fade 🔥 As you progress, frameworks step in 🛠️ React, Angular, Vue — not as crutches, but as force multipliers for what you already know 🚀 Then comes the real growth phase 📈 Clean code, reusable components, task runners, smart architecture — This is where learning turns into craftsmanship 💪 Behind the scenes ⚙️ Servers, APIs, databases, and logic work quietly powering every click, login, and transaction 🌐 Whether you choose Frontend ❤️, Backend 💙, or Full Stack 🔥 Remember this — clarity + consistency beats speed 📊 Don’t rush the process ⏳ Learn deeply. Build often. Break things. Fix them. Repeat 🔁 Your roadmap is in your hands — and the destination is absolutely worth it ✨ #WebDevelopment #FrontendDeveloper #BackendDeveloper #FullStackDeveloper #DeveloperRoadmap #ProgrammingJourney #LearnToCode #CodingLife #SoftwareEngineer #TechCareers #JavaScript #ReactJS #NodeJS #Angular #CareerInTech
To view or add a comment, sign in
-
-
Angular tips I’ve learned in my 2 years as a Frontend Developer 🚀 Still learning every day, but these small practices helped me write cleaner and faster Angular code. 🔹 Tip #1: Use trackBy in *ngFor I learned this while working with large lists—Angular re-renders less and feels much faster. 👉 Small change, big performance boost. 🔹 Tip #2: Prefer async pipe over manual subscriptions Earlier, I used to subscribe everywhere. Now I let Angular handle it. 👉 Cleaner code + fewer memory leaks. 🔹 Tip #3: Keep business logic out of components Move API calls and logic to services. 👉 Components stay readable and easy to maintain. 🔹 Tip #4: Use OnPush when performance matters Especially useful in reusable or shared components. 👉 Better performance with minimal effort. 🔹 Tip #5: ng-container helps keep the DOM clean No unnecessary divs, just better structure. 🔹 Tip #6: Always unsubscribe (unless using async pipe) Unsubscribed observables caused me bugs early in my career. 👉 Lesson learned the hard way 😅 🔹 Tip #7: Lazy load feature modules Helps reduce initial load time in real-world apps. #Angular #FrontendDeveloper #WebDevelopment #SoftwareEngineering #LearningInPublic
To view or add a comment, sign in
-
-
💡 React vs Angular: It’s not about which is better, it’s about which fits your project best ✅ Here’s how I look at it as a frontend developer: 🔵 React • UI library, not a full framework. • Lets you compose your own stack by choosing your router, state, and data layer. • Works best when you need flexibility and gradual adoption within an existing codebase. 🔴 Angular • A complete, opinionated framework • Built with TypeScript at its core, including modules, dependency injection, routing, forms, and HTTP out of the box • Best for large teams that want structure and consistency How I decide: 🟦 Need flexibility, a lighter setup, and the freedom to build my own stack → React 🟥 Need a complete, structured solution with strong conventions → Angular ❓ What are you using for your next project: React or Angular, and why? #ReactJS #Angular #JavaScript #TypeScript #FrontendDevelopment #WebDevelopment #FullStackDevelopment
To view or add a comment, sign in
-
-
A career in development isn’t built overnight — it’s built step by step 🧩💻 Start with the basics 🧱 HTML for structure, CSS for design, JavaScript for logic ⚡ Because strong fundamentals never go out of trend 🔥 As you grow, frameworks become your tools 🛠️ React, Angular, Vue — not to replace your knowledge, but to amplify it 🚀 Then comes the advanced phase 📈 Task runners, preprocessors, clean architecture, reusable components — this is where beginners transform into professionals 💪 On the back-end side ⚙️ Languages, databases, APIs, and servers work silently behind the scenes 🧠 Powering every click, login, and transaction 🌐 Whether you choose Front-end ❤️, Back-end 💙, or Full Stack 🔥 remember one thing — clarity + consistency = growth 📊 Don’t rush the journey 🕰️ Learn deeply. Build projects. Break things. Fix them. Repeat 🔁 Your roadmap is your responsibility — but your destination is worth it 🚀✨ hashtag #WebDevelopment hashtag #FrontendDeveloper hashtag #BackendDeveloper hashtag #FullStackDeveloper hashtag #DeveloperRoadmap hashtag #ProgrammingJourney hashtag #LearnToCode hashtag #CodingLife hashtag #SoftwareEngineer hashtag #TechCareers hashtag #JavaScript hashtag #ReactJS hashtag #NodeJS hashtag #Angular hashtag #CareerInTech
To view or add a comment, sign in
-
-
A career in development isn’t created in a day — it’s shaped one step at a time 🧩💻 Begin with the fundamentals 🧱 HTML builds the structure, CSS brings the style, and JavaScript adds logic Because solid basics never lose their value 🔥 As you progress, frameworks become your allies 🛠️ React, Angular, Vue — not as replacements, but as boosters to what you already know 🚀 Next comes the advanced stage 📈 Task runners, preprocessors, clean architecture, reusable components — this is where learners evolve into professionals 💪 On the back-end side ⚙️ Languages, databases, APIs, and servers quietly do the heavy lifting 🧠 Supporting every click, login, and transaction 🌐 Whether you choose Front-end ❤️, Back-end 💙, or Full Stack 🔥 remember this — clarity + consistency drive real growth 📊 Don’t rush the process 🕰️ Learn with depth. Build projects. Break things. Fix them. Repeat 🔁 Your roadmap is your own responsibility — and the destination is absolutely worth it 🚀✨ #WebDevelopment #FrontendDeveloper #BackendDeveloper #FullStackDeveloper #DeveloperRoadmap #ProgrammingJourney #LearnToCode #CodingLife #SoftwareEngineer #TechCareers #JavaScript #ReactJS #NodeJS #Angular #CareerInTech
To view or add a comment, sign in
-
-
JavaScript is not just a language; it’s an ecosystem. When I first started learning JavaScript, I thought it was only about writing scripts for the browser. Over time, I realized how deeply it connects frontend, backend, mobile, desktop, and databases into one powerful stack. This roadmap reflects how JavaScript evolves from fundamentals (HTML, CSS, JS) to frameworks (React, Angular, Vue), then into backend and full-stack development (Node.js, Express, Next.js), and even hybrid applications like React Native and Electron. I’m currently focusing on building a strong foundation, step by step, instead of rushing into everything at once. My goal is simple: learn deeply, build consistently, and grow professionally. This is my first post of the week, and I plan to share my learning journey, insights, and lessons regularly. If you’re also learning or working with JavaScript, I’d love to connect and exchange ideas. Consistency over intensity. Progress over perfection. #JavaScript #WebDevelopment #Frontend #FullStack #React #LearningInPublic #SoftwareEngineering #CareerGrowth
To view or add a comment, sign in
-
-
⚔️ Angular vs React — Not a Battle, a Choice 💙⚛️ Let’s stop comparing frameworks like teams and start choosing them like tools 🧰 🔴 Angular — The Structured Powerhouse ✔️ Full-fledged framework ✔️ Built-in routing, forms, HTTP & security ✔️ TypeScript-first & opinionated ✔️ Ideal for large-scale & enterprise apps ✔️ Clean architecture for long-term projects Angular shines when structure & scalability matter. 🔵 React — The Flexible UI Champion ✔️ Component-based library ✔️ Minimal & flexible approach ✔️ Massive ecosystem ✔️ Fast UI rendering ✔️ Perfect for dynamic & interactive interfaces React shines when speed & flexibility matter. 🧠 The Real Truth? There is NO winner here. ✔️ Angular excels at discipline & architecture ✔️ React excels at freedom & UI flexibility The best framework is the one that: 👉 Fits your project size 👉 Matches your team mindset 👉 Solves your real-world problem 🚀 Developers don’t pick sides. They pick solutions. Angular 🤝 React Both are powerful. Both are future-proof. 💬 Let’s engage 👇 Which one do you enjoy working with more — and why? (Not which is better. Which fits YOU.) #Angular #ReactJS #WebDevelopment #FrontendDeveloper #JavaScript #TypeScript #SoftwareEngineering #DeveloperCommunity #TechCareers
To view or add a comment, sign in
-
Explore content categories
- Career
- Productivity
- Finance
- Soft Skills & Emotional Intelligence
- Project Management
- Education
- Technology
- Leadership
- Ecommerce
- User Experience
- Recruitment & HR
- Customer Experience
- Real Estate
- Marketing
- Sales
- Retail & Merchandising
- Science
- Supply Chain Management
- Future Of Work
- Consulting
- Writing
- Economics
- Artificial Intelligence
- Employee Experience
- Workplace Trends
- Fundraising
- Networking
- Corporate Social Responsibility
- Negotiation
- Communication
- Engineering
- Hospitality & Tourism
- Business Strategy
- Change Management
- Organizational Culture
- Design
- Innovation
- Event Planning
- Training & Development